30KPA198CA-B Product Overview
Introduction
The 30KPA198CA-B is a specialized electronic component designed for use in various applications. This entry provides an in-depth overview of the product, including its category, basic information, specifications, pin configuration, functional features, advantages and disadvantages, working principles, application field plans, and alternative models.
Basic Information Overview
- Category: Electronic Component
- Use: Surge Protection
- Characteristics: High Power Handling, Fast Response Time
- Package: Axial Lead
- Essence: Protects Against Voltage Surges
- Packaging/Quantity: Bulk Packaging, Quantity Varies
Specifications
- Voltage Rating: 198V
- Peak Pulse Power: 30,000W
- Breakdown Voltage: 220V
- Maximum Clamping Voltage: 320V
- Operating Temperature: -55°C to +175°C
- Storage Temperature: -55°C to +175°C

Working Principles
The 30KPA198CA-B operates based on the principle of avalanche breakdown, where it rapidly clamps transient voltages to protect downstream electronic devices from damage.
